SHAWNEE – Oklahoma Baptist women's golf kicks off their spring schedule Monday at the St. Edward's Invitational, played at Onion Creek Club in Austin, Texas.
Â
The Lady Bison compiled four straight top-five finishes to close out the fall season, ending in a third place finish at the NCCAA National Championship.
Â
Freshman
Elly Baze earned NCCAA All-America honors with a 10th place finish at the championship, edging out another freshman
Michelle Carr in 11th place.
Â
Junior
Kadrian Shelton looks to build on a strong fall season after she registered two top-15 finishes. Sophomore
Shannen Stewart owns the low round of the season for the Lady Bison at even par 72 in the fall.
Â
The lone senior in the top five is
Emma Williams, who begins her final spring on Bison Hill after a 38th place finish in the final tournament of the fall.
Â
OBU will play 18 holes on Monday and Tuesday in the 36-hole event.
